Pool site grading services involve leveling and shaping the land around a swimming pool area to ensure proper drainage and stability.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and creating a smooth, even surface that directs water away from the pool and foundation. Proper grading helps prevent water from pooling near the pool structure, which can cause damage, erosion, or uneven surfaces that affect the safety and usability of the pool area.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to achieve accurate slopes and contours, ensuring the site is prepared for the next stages of pool installation or renovation.
These services are essential for addressing common problems such as poor drainage, uneven ground, and soil erosion that can compromise the integrity of a pool and its surrounding area. Without proper grading, water may collect around the pool, leading to issues like cracked concrete, shifting ground, or water infiltration into the pool shell. Grading also helps to create a stable foundation for pool decking, fencing, and landscaping, reducing the risk of future repairs or safety hazards. The overview below groups typical Pool Site Grading proj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Monroe, LA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or grading or leveling work on smaller pool sites range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on site size and soil conditions. Fewer projects will push into the higher end of this band.
Moderate Projects - Medium-scale grading or partial site prep usually costs between $600 and $1,500. These projects often involve more extensive soil work or minor excavation, which local contractors handle regularly. Larger, more complex jobs can reach higher costs within this range.
Large-Scale Site Preparation - For bigger pool installations requiring significant grading, costs typically range from $1,500 to $3,500. Many projects in this category are routine for experienced local pros, but costs can vary based on terrain and project scope.
Full Site Overhaul - Complete grading and site prep for large or complex pool projects can exceed $3,500 and reach $5,000 or more. These are less common but necessary for extensive excavation or challenging soil conditions, with costs depending heavily on site specifics.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is pool site grading? Pool site grading involves leveling and shaping the land around a pool area to ensure proper drainage and stability, helping to prevent issues like shifting or water pooling.
Why is proper grading important for a new pool? Proper grading helps maintain the integrity of the pool structure, improves drainage, and reduces the risk of erosion or water damage over time.
How do local contractors handle pool site grading? Local contractors assess the terrain, remove excess soil if needed, and create a slope that directs water away from the pool area for optimal stability.
What should I consider before starting pool site grading? It's important to evaluate the existing land conditions, drainage patterns, and any potential obstacles to ensure effective grading by experienced service providers.
Can existing pools require grading adjustments? Yes, if drainage issues or shifting occur, local service providers can perform grading adjustments to restore proper land slope and stability around the pool.
